Angrist was a knife made by the Dwarf-smith Telchar for the Elf-lord Curufin in the First Age. It was taken from Curufin by Beren Erchamion during the Quest for the Silmaril, who used it to cut through the Iron Crown of Morgoth and free a Silmaril. The blade snapped, however, and Morgoth stirred as a shard grazed his brow. Beren left Angrist behind as he escaped.

Angrist means "Iron Cleaver" in Sindarin (from ang = "iron" and crist = "cleaver").
